Houston region to host inaugural clinic for people with disabilities May 4

From the Houston Leader

“Residents who need assistance preparing for disaster are invited to a special clinic hosted by a group of preparedness organizations. Partners from across the Houston and Harris County region will sponsor a Disaster Readiness and Resilience Clinic (DRRC) to help people with [disabilities] prepare for emergencies.

The clinic is set from 9 a.m. to 3 p.m., Saturday, May 4, at the Metropolitan Multi-Service Center, 1475 West Gray. It will offer a range of services and resources designed to empower vulnerable people to better plan for and navigate through disasters.”
